Timahoe – a towering example of the delights on our doorstep
The Timahoe Round Tower is intriguing and every bit as significant as the more illustrious Glendalough. It took over 30 years to construct in the 12th century, containing six floors of ornate design in the Hiberno-Romanesque style. We have learned many things and a...

A Clonmacnoise confession, some redemption in Shannonbridge
Shannonbridge just 8km from Clonmacnoise is a lovely stop-off. Its 16-span bridge across the River Shannon dates back to 1757 linking the village's past and present, it's interesting heritage as well as it's vast potential to welcome visitors. I have a confession to...
